The boys team placed 2nd with 71 points. The highlight of the meet was a stunning 1-2-3 finish in the 1600. Conrad Schultz won with a season best 4:31. Freshman Logan Kleam finished 2nd with a PR of 4:33 (currently the #2 9th grader in D1). The 3200 Relay of Cameron Karagitz, Logan Kleam, Eric Wilkewitz and Conrad Schultz placed second with a season's best time of 8:24. Kenny Williams held the lead in the Long Jump until the 2nd to last jump and had to settle for 2nd place. Kyle Martin placed 3rd in the Vault equalling his 12' PR. The sprint relays of Desmond, Jones, Matt Jordan, Kenny Williams and Niko France pklaced 4th in 400 & 800 Relays.

The Warriors Boys took a a tough one point loss to Trenton on Tuesday, 69-68. The Warrior swept all four relays. Warrior winners in the Open events were: Niko France (100), Conrad Schultz (1600 and 3200), Cameron Karagitz (800), and Desmond Jones (200). The second place finishers were: Kenny Williams (Long Jump), Kyle Martin (Pole Vault), Matt Jordan(400), Logan Kleam(3200), France (200), and Karagitz(1600).
The Warrior Boys are 1-1 in Downriver League competition.
At the Jefferson Invite on Saturday the Boys placed 6th in the 15 team field. Kenny Williams won the Long Jump on cold, blustery day with a personal best jump of 20'9.5". The Warrior distance crew had a nice day with Conrad Schultz, Cameron Karagitz and Logan Kleam placing 2nd, 3rd and 5th in the 1600 (with times of 4:36, 4:41 and 4:45 respectively). Schultz was 3rd in the 3200 (10:01) and Kleam placed 5th (10:28). Karagitz was 5th in the 800. Other scorers were: Niko France (100-5th), and Desmond Jones (LJ-8th). The 400 relay was 8th, 3200 relay was 4th and the 880 relay was 4th.
